Meaning & Etymology
bright, shining one
The name Eleni is derived from the Greek name 'Helene', which means 'torch' or 'light'. It has been adopted into the Tigrinya culture, where it is associated with brightness and positivity.

Etymology
The name Eleni derives from the Greek name Helene, which has Semitic influences in its Tigrinya adaptation.
Linguistic family: Afroasiatic > Semitic > South Semitic > Ethiopian Semitic
Cultural context
In Eritrean Tigrinya culture, Eleni is a name that signifies brightness and positivity. It is often given to girls born during times of joy or celebration.
Symbolism
The name Eleni symbolises light, hope, and the promise of a bright future. It is often associated with qualities of leadership and grace.
Naming ceremony
In Tigrinya tradition, the naming ceremony (Timqat) involves the child being blessed by a priest and introduced to the community. The name Eleni would be bestowed during this ceremony.
